There are two types of backups:

1. Autosave backups that happen every N minutes (a user-configurable 
interval), and have an ASV extension, AND

2. Backups made each time you save the file, which have a BAK 
extension.

If you have both turned on, you'll get:

  MyMusic.mus
  MyMusic.asv
  MyMusic.bak

These may or may not be in the same folder as your MUS file (you can 
have a separate folder for both ASV and for BAK files, configurable 
in Program Options under FOLDERS, at least, it used to be there). 

The backup files are for recovery when something goes wrong. 
Otherwise, you can ignore them.
